Byron Kaverman raised under the gun to 150,000, Sean Perry called from the cutoff, and Rania Nasreddine called from the big blind, leaving herself just a single 25K chip behind.

The flop came 7d5d2s, Nasreddine checked, Kaverman bet 225,000, and Perry folded.

Nasreddine called all in for 25,000 with Ac4d for ace high with a gutshot straight draw, but she needed to improve to stay alive against Kaverman’s Ad5s (pair of fives).

The turn card was the 5c, the river card was the 9h, and Kaverman won the pot with trip fives to eliminate Nasreddine in eighth place.
